MLB

Miami Marlins @ Kansas City Royals - June 25, 2024

June 25, 2024, 8:29am EDT

Odds Provided By
BetUS logo

SPREAD PICK

Kansas City Royals

-1.5

Bet Amount

$

Potential Payout

Potential Payout

Values are based on the payout of the Best Value odds plus initial bet amount.

Top Betting Site

BetUS

-1.5

+114

MONEYLINE PICK

Kansas City Royals

Bet Amount

$

Potential Payout

Potential Payout

Values are based on the payout of the Best Value odds plus initial bet amount.

Top Betting Site

BetUS

KC

-182

OVER/UNDER PICK

Over

10.5

Bet Amount

$

Potential Payout

Potential Payout

Values are based on the payout of the Best Value odds plus initial bet amount.

Top Betting Site

BetUS

10.5

-102

As a retired coach with years of experience under my belt, I can’t help but get excited when analyzing the upcoming game between the Kansas City Royals and the Miami Marlins. The predictions are in, and all signs point to a victory for the Royals tonight. Let’s break down why this outcome is likely to happen.

On the mound for the Royals is Seth Lugo, boasting an impressive 10-2 win-loss record this season. Lugo has been a reliable force for the team with a solid 3.9 ERA and 7.8 strikeouts per game. His consistency and ability to control the game’s pace make him a formidable opponent for any lineup.

Meanwhile, the Marlins will be sending Yonny Chirinos to pitch, who is currently sitting at a 0-0 win-loss record with a 4.7 ERA and 8 strikeouts per game. While Chirinos has shown potential on the mound, he lacks the experience and track record that Lugo brings to the table.

When we shift our focus to batting statistics, we see that the Royals have been putting up impressive numbers this season, averaging 4.6 runs, 8.2 hits, and 4.4 RBIs per game. With a batting average of .241 and an on-base slugging percentage of nearly 70%, it’s clear that their offense is firing on all cylinders.

On the other side, the Marlins have struggled offensively, averaging only 3.5 runs, 7.8 hits, and 3.4 RBIs per game with a .227 batting average and a slugging percentage of around 61%. These numbers suggest that they may have trouble generating runs against Lugo and the Royals’ solid pitching staff.

Considering these factors, it’s no surprise that many are predicting an over outcome in terms of total runs scored in this matchup. The Royals’ strong pitching combined with their potent offense gives them a clear advantage over the Marlins in this game.

In conclusion, expect an exciting showdown between these two teams tonight with the Kansas City Royals coming out on top due to their superior pitching staff and high-powered offense. As always in baseball, anything can happen on any given night – but based on the stats and predictions, it looks like it will be a good night for Kansas City fans as they cheer their team to victory against Miami.

Kansas City Royals vs Miami Marlins
Live Odds & Betting History

Betting odds provided by BetUS

Wager TypeKansas City RoyalsMiami Marlins
Spread-1.5 (+114) +1.5 (-141)
Moneyline-182+153
TotalUnder 10.5 (-125)Over 10.5 (-102)
Team DataKansas City RoyalsMiami Marlins
Runs4.573.52
Hits8.167.84
Runs Batted In4.433.43
Batting Average0.2410.227
On-Base Slugging69.55%61.58%
Walks2.782.04
Strikeouts7.758.01
Earned Run Average3.914.74
Beat the Geek NFL contest